The International Justice Mission (IJM) Ghana has honoured the Head of Adom News and Current Affairs, Martha Crentsil Acquah, for her consistent contribution to the fight against human trafficking and the protection of vulnerable children over the past four years.
The recognition was presented during a media soirée held after a workshop for journalists on human trafficking and related issues at Aburi.

Speaking at the event, Community Engagement Associate for IJM Ghana, Love Kyeremah-Darko, described Martha Crentsil Acquah as a dependable media partner who has consistently used journalism to amplify issues affecting vulnerable people in society.
According to her, Mrs. Acquah has played a key role in drawing public attention to the realities of human trafficking and the urgent need to protect children.

The event formed part of IJM Ghana’s broader efforts to strengthen media collaboration in the fight against human trafficking and child protection abuses in the country.
